Description



Salary: £40,000 to £55,000 DOE – Benefits include Pension, Parking, Commission/Bonus, Gym Membership, Childcare Vouchers



Working as a part of the existing product design team you will be responsible for the design and development of microelectronics circuits for future company products. The role includes:

 

·         Analogue/digital electronics design and PCB layout including design constraints, component footprint editing, placement, routing and Gerber file (RS274x) creation.

·         Experience of hardware debugging, using oscilloscopes, spectrum analysers and other test equipment.

·         Assistance in the generation of supporting technical documentation (e.g. assembly drawings, BoMs, manufacturing packs).

·         Organizing, participating in and documenting design reviews.

·         Regular reporting of project progress.

 

The successful candidate should have the following experience:

 

·         A diploma or degree in a related engineering discipline.

·         2+ years’ overall electronics design experience in a commercial environment.

·         2+ years’ experience using Cadence Allegro and OrCAD design software to design multilayer PCBs (2 to 4+ layers typically).

·         Knowledge of communication bus protocols (including USB, SPI, I2C, CAN bus, RS232, SDIO & Ethernet).

·         A proven track record in both analogue and digital layout and design for test and manufacture.

·         Understanding of signal integrity, PCB stack-up, impedance control, ESD and EMC compliance.

 

In Addition:

 

·         Some knowledge of GNSS and/or automotive industry applications would be advantageous – not essential

·         Experience in writing technical documentation would be desirable – not essential

 

You should also be able to demonstrate and give evidence at interview of:

 

·         Team working.

·         Attention to detail and focus on quality.

·         Being organised, innovative and self-motivated with the ability to work under time-scale pressure.

·         Excellent communication skills with the ability to participate in technical discussions and understand & discuss complex ideas.

·         Desire to learn and understand the fundamentals inherent in our designs i.e. high accuracy GPS.
